Anonymous wrote:Kamala isn't even at the DNC today. She left for Milwaukee. Is this normal?

Yes, in years past the candidate wouldn’t arrive until Thursday. More recently there have been the surprise first day appearances like Harris did last night and Trump has done in the past. But no, it’s not normal for the candidate to stay in their seat at the convention the whole time.
